Abstract :
Amplifiers utilizing autozeroing suffer from clock spurs at the sampling frequency. This paper describes a method of controlling the clock in order to reduce the amplitude of the spurs in the frequency domain, allowing a wider spurious-free dynamic range for signals with bandwidths approaching or exceeding the sampling frequency. Improvements of 20 dB were measured when using this technique
